Reality has bitten, I need to get a car Mrs Ruff can learn to drive in, and so my fleet of three must lose it's newest member as the other two vehicles are non negotiable.

 

It's a 2004 reg C15 with the DW8 engine, just shy of 90k with receipts for clutch and cambelt as well as some new front discs and pads.

 

I've had the van 3 months now and for it's MOT I have replaced both front arms (TCA bushes were worn) and both fron ARB bushes.

 

It has 5 good budget tyres and H4 spec headlamp bulbs.

 

It's a scruffy noisy little thing, but mechanically it's spot on, oh save for a slight blow on the exhaust, but I'm hoping to source a good second hand one next week.

 

post-2711-0-91856900-1413311171_thumb.jpg

 

 

It will come with a full MOT, a few spare bits I have and an Autoshite window sticker. Also has enough history to choke a donkey.

 

The price is a firm £700. If I advertise elsewhere, I will apply a £150 knobhead tax.
